> Log:
> README: Reduce the textdump; describe the project
>
> Rework the README to make it a little easier for new users. This is the
> first file many will see when persuing the FreeBSD source code so
>
> - remove some of the text describes how to build. This is better covered
> in the linked documentation.
> - add a small blurb for what FreeBSD is. Some users might find this
> document through features such as github search so they may not even
> know what the project is
>
> generally, gear this file for the new, accidental, or casual user rather
> than towards someone seeking fuller documentation.

Changes to "the first file many will see when perusing the FreeBSD source
code" seem like something sufficiently impactful that pre-commit review
and/or
consultation with other committers would be advised.
(That said, these changes do seem reasonable, on a quick read.)
